What Will You Learn in a BCA Course?
Modern BCA programs are much more practical than they were a few years ago.
Programming Languages
Students typically learn:
Python
Java
C++
JavaScript
These languages are widely used across software development and automation.
Database Management
Students understand how applications store and manage information using SQL, MySQL, and database design principles.
Web Development
Most colleges now include front-end and back-end development using HTML, CSS, JavaScript, PHP, or frameworks like React.
Cloud Computing
Cloud platforms such as AWS and Microsoft Azure have become essential skills for modern developers.
Artificial Intelligence Basics
Many updated curricula introduce students to machine learning concepts, AI applications, and automation tools.
Software Development Projects
Practical projects help students build portfolios that improve placement opportunities.
Career Opportunities After a BCA Degree
One of the biggest advantages of earning a BCA degree is the wide range of career options available.
Popular career paths include:
Software Developer: Develop and maintain applications for businesses, startups, or multinational companies.
Web Developer: Create responsive websites and web applications for clients across industries.
Mobile App Developer: Design Android and iOS applications using modern development frameworks.
Data Analyst: Analyze business data to support decision-making using visualization and analytics tools.
Cybersecurity Analyst: Protect organizations from cyber threats and ensure information security.
Cloud Support Engineer: Manage cloud infrastructure and deployment services.
UI/UX Designer: Combine creativity with technology to design user-friendly digital experiences.
IT Support Specialist: Help organizations maintain computer systems and solve technical issues.
Many graduates also pursue freelancing or launch their own software businesses.

Understanding BCA Course Fees
One common question students ask is about BCA course fees.
The fee structure varies depending on the institution.
Generally:
Government colleges: Lower tuition fees
Private colleges: Moderate to higher fees depending on infrastructure
Institutes offering placement assistance and industry certifications may charge more due to additional training.
Instead of choosing a college solely based on BCA course fees, evaluate:
Placement record
Updated curriculum
Industry partnerships
Faculty expertise
Internship opportunities
Modern computer labs
Practical learning approach
A slightly higher investment often delivers significantly better career outcomes.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Is a bachelor of computer application good for future careers?
Yes. A bachelor of computer application provides a strong foundation for software development, cloud computing, cybersecurity, and data analytics careers, making it a valuable choice for the evolving technology industry.
2. What is the average BCA course duration?
Most BCA courses are three-year undergraduate degree programs divided into six semesters.
3. What are typical BCA course fees?
BCA course fees vary widely depending on the institution, location, and facilities. Government colleges generally charge less than private institutes.
4. Can I get a good job after a BCA degree?
Yes. Graduates can work as software developers, web developers, IT support specialists, data analysts, cloud engineers, and cybersecurity professionals, especially when they have practical projects and internships.
5. Can I pursue higher education after BCA?
Absolutely. Many students continue with MCA, MBA, postgraduate diplomas, or specialized certifications in AI, cloud computing, cybersecurity, or data science.
